Kotlin 擴展函數是一種在已有類上添加新功能的方式,而無需繼承該類或使用其他設計模式。要掌握 Kotlin 擴展函數,可以遵循以下步驟: 1. 了解擴展函數的概念和用途:擴展函數允許你在不修改原...
Kotlin 擴展函數是一種在已有類上添加新功能的方法,它允許你在不修改原有類的情況下擴展其功能。擴展函數在 Kotlin 中被廣泛應用于各種場景,以下是一些常見的應用示例: 1. **集合類**:...
Kotlin 擴展函數是一種在已有類上添加新功能的方法,它不會修改原有類的代碼。要優化 Kotlin 擴展函數,可以遵循以下幾點: 1. 使用擴展屬性:如果需要為類添加只讀屬性,可以使用擴展屬性。這...
Kotlin 擴展函數是一種特殊的函數,它允許你為現有的類添加新的功能,而無需繼承該類或使用其他設計模式。擴展函數在 Kotlin 中非常有用,因為它們提供了一種簡潔、易于閱讀的方式來擴展現有類的功能...
在 Kotlin 中,伴生對象(Companion Object)是一種特殊的類成員,它允許你在不創建類實例的情況下訪問類的靜態方法和屬性。伴生對象在 Kotlin 中非常常見,它們提供了一種簡潔的方...
Kotlin 伴生對象(Companion Object)是一種特殊的類成員,它允許你在不創建類的新實例的情況下訪問其屬性和方法 1. 靜態成員:伴生對象的屬性和方法都是靜態的,這意味著它們可以直接...
Kotlin 伴生對象(Companion Object)是一種特殊的類,它用于在同一個文件中定義單例對象。要改進 Kotlin 伴生對象,可以考慮以下幾個方面: 1. 使用 `const val`...
在 Kotlin 中,伴生對象(Companion Object)是一種特殊的類,它用于為另一個類提供靜態方法和屬性。要訪問伴生對象的成員,你需要使用伴生對象的名稱作為前綴。這里有一個簡單的例子來說明...
Kotlin 伴生對象(Companion Object)是一種特殊的類,它用于封裝與主類相關的工具函數和常量。要優化 Kotlin 伴生對象,可以遵循以下幾點建議: 1. 使用 `const va...
在 Kotlin 中,伴生對象(Companion Object)是一種特殊的類,它用于為另一個類提供靜態方法和屬性。要創建一個伴生對象,請按照以下步驟操作: 1. 在類定義的內部,使用 `comp...